The hands-free card lets you unlock the car even when keys are in the ignition. The hands-free card can be used to illuminate the dashboard or as an alternative to a remote control for the onboard computer. The system is vulnerable to errors, however it can be prone to errors, for instance, when the user washes the card or the battery is exhausted. Renault has solved this issue by hiding an ignition card within the card. This card can be used to manually unlock the doors in the event that there is a malfunction or battery failure.

Renault key cards can be effective in preventing theft, as they make it difficult for thieves hot-wire your vehicle. It operates by sending a code to the vehicle's ECU. The engine will only start if both codes are the same. This is an effective way to deter car thieves and also save money on insurance rates.



The cards include blades that can be used as an emergency key to manually open the doors. They also come with a button that can be used to lock the doors and activate the immobiliser. Renault key cards are designed in a different way from conventional car keys, but perform the same. They can be put in the panel reader of the dashboard and used to unlock the vehicle.
